A Reading Theorist's World View through the Lens of Terrence Malick: The "Poem" Created from Transacting "the Tree of Life" Trailer
Malich, John; Kehus, Marcella J.
Journal of Visual Literacy, v31 n1 p1-22 2012
In our essay we discuss Louise Rosenblatt's transactional theory of a reading event. Second, we summarize Carole Cox and Joyce Many who applied the transactional theory and designed a 1-5 point continuum to stories and films. Third, we summarize film theorists David Bordwell's constructivism; Richard Wollheim's central imagining and identification; and Noel Carroll's unanimous empathy. These scholars provide quantitative and theoretical support connecting a literary theory to The Tree of Life trailer and the comments written. Our essay found the Top voted comments to be more evident of critical reading as users voted comments with more complexity into higher visibility. (Contains 1 figure and 2 tables.)
